Your go-to shoe for the transition from trail to town and back again, the Merrell ™ Geomorph Maze Stretch hiking shoe will keep you going no matter the terrain. Lightweight and comfortable, you'll get a jaw-dropping response time allowing quick directional changes. Reinforced with leather, this shoe delivers added lateral stability in addition to a super-secure fit with the one-cinch lacing system.

FEATURES:

  • Strobel construction offers flexibility and comfort
  • Nubuck leather and mesh upper allows stability and breathability in one
  • Low cut upper minimizes hot spots
  • Elastic cord and lock lacing system gives a quick, secure fit
  • Mesh lining treated with Aegis ® antimicrobial solution to resist odor
  • EVA removable footbed treated with Aegis ® antimicrobial solution
  • Merrell ™ air cushion in the heel absorbs shock and adds stability
  • Vibram ® Geomorph Sole/TC5+ Rubber adds unbeatable traction

Nice shoe, looks good This is my second pair of the Merrell Geomorph. My first pair still looks good after a year of use and is one of the most comfortable shoes I've had. For me, it's a great all around work or play shoe. I wore the older pair through the winter. Traction is good in snow and ice and the shoes still look great so I got a second pair in another color. I wouldn't recommend this shoe for lengthy hikes since the stretch upper provides less support and protection than other hiking shoes. The stretch style seems a little tight at first but after a couple of weeks, fits like a second skin. April 19, 2013

Perfect fit for a weekend hike I used this shoe for a camping trip in a state park down in Kentucky. We went on a 7.5 mile hiking trip that Saturday and this shoe did the trick. Great on the beaten path with good traction and also on the slate and rocky terrain we had to traverse. Poured down rain for last 1.5 miles of trip and my feet were still dry from the elements at the end of the trip. Might not be the softest sole out there, but I had no foot pain after, either. Room for an insole of your choice. Have care with holes, etc. It's a stretch shoe, so could potentially get pulled off (didn't happen to me). Still had a great weekend! October 16, 2012
